TinyTap Pro games are activities created by experienced teachers that are sold on the TinyTap market. 50% of revenue from TinyTap Pro subscriptions is shared with teachers who create on TinyTap. And, when you sell your activity on TinyTap, you receive a portion of revenues from TinyTap Pro sales. Get your students quickly signed into their own accounts and playing lessons with QR Login. It is not easy for younger students to remember usernames and passwords. And, logging into accounts for an entire class should be fast and easy for teachers. To make it easy for students to sign into their own accounts, TinyTap generates a unique QR code for each student’s account.
